Friends according to the media reports,The United States has granted India a temporary 30-day waiver (valid through April 3, 2026) to purchase Russian crude oil to help stabilize global energy markets during the ongoing conflict in the Middle East.
Key Waiver Terms
Authorized Transactions: The waiver, issued by the US Treasury Office of Foreign Assets Control, applies specifically to Russian oil and petroleum products already loaded onto vessels as of March 5, 2026.
Duration: The exemption is a short-term stopgap measure that expires at the end of the day on April 3, 2026 (12:01 a.m. Washington time on April 4).
Scope: It primarily targets stranded oil already at sea to prevent supply shortages without providing significant new financial benefits to the Russian government.
Context for the Decision
Middle East Supply Crunch: The waiver follows disruptions in the West Asia region, including the reported closure of the Strait of Hormuz by Iran, which has threatened nearly 20% of the world's oil and gas supply.
India's Energy Security: India relies on the Middle East for approximately 40% of its oil imports. With regional shipping routes under threat, Indian refiners have reportedly already purchased roughly 20 million barrels of Russian oil from traders to secure prompt deliveries.
US Expectations: US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ent stated that while this measure alleviates immediate pressure, Washington expects India, as an essential partner, to eventually increase its purchases of US oil.source media reports.
